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CHv3] qxl: bump pci rev

From: Gerd Hoffmann <kraxel@redhat.com>
Inform guest drivers about the new features I/O commands we have
now (async commands, S3 support) if building with newer spice, i.e.
if SPICE_INTERFACE_QXL_MINOR >= 1.
Signed-off-by: Gerd Hoffmann <kraxel@redhat.com>
---
hw/qxl.c | 11 ++++++++---
hw/qxl.h | 6 ++++++
2 files changed, 14 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
diff --git a/hw/qxl.c b/hw/qxl.c
index ae1d0de..d3b1581 100644
--- a/hw/qxl.c
+++ b/hw/qxl.c
@@ -1389,9 +1389,14 @@ static int qxl_init_common(PCIQXLDevice *qxl)
pci_device_rev = QXL_REVISION_STABLE_V04;
break;
case 2: /* spice 0.6 -- qxl-2 */
- default:
pci_device_rev = QXL_REVISION_STABLE_V06;
break;
+#if SPICE_INTERFACE_QXL_MINOR >= 1
+ case 3: /* qxl-3 */
+#endif
+ default:
+ pci_device_rev = QXL_DEFAULT_REVISION;
+ break;
}
pci_set_byte(&config[PCI_REVISION_ID], pci_device_rev);
@@ -1655,7 +1660,7 @@ static PCIDeviceInfo qxl_info_primary = {
.qdev.props = (Property[]) {
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("ram_size", PCIQXLDevice, vga.vram_size, 64 * 1024 * 1024),
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("vram_size", PCIQXLDevice, vram_size, 64 * 1024 * 1024),
- D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("revision", PCIQXLDevice, revision, 2),
+ D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("revision", PCIQXLDevice, revision, QXL_DEFAULT_REVISION),
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("debug", PCIQXLDevice, debug, 0),
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("guestdebug", PCIQXLDevice, guestdebug, 0),
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("cmdlog", PCIQXLDevice, cmdlog, 0),
@@ -1676,7 +1681,7 @@ static PCIDeviceInfo qxl_info_secondary = {
.qdev.props = (Property[]) {
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("ram_size", PCIQXLDevice, vga.vram_size, 64 * 1024 * 1024),
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("vram_size", PCIQXLDevice, vram_size, 64 * 1024 * 1024),
- D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("revision", PCIQXLDevice, revision, 2),
+ D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("revision", PCIQXLDevice, revision, QXL_DEFAULT_REVISION),
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("debug", PCIQXLDevice, debug, 0),
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("guestdebug", PCIQXLDevice, guestdebug, 0),
DEFINE_PROP_UINT32("cmdlog", PCIQXLDevice, cmdlog, 0),
diff --git a/hw/qxl.h b/hw/qxl.h
index e361bc6..85d37be 100644
--- a/hw/qxl.h
+++ b/hw/qxl.h
@@ -97,6 +97,12 @@ typedef struct PCIQXLDevice {
} \
} while (0)
+#if SPICE_INTERFACE_QXL_MINOR >= 1
+#define QXL_DEFAULT_REVISION QXL_REVISION_STABLE_V10
+#else
+#define QXL_DEFAULT_REVISION QXL_REVISION_STABLE_V06
+#endif
+
/* qxl.c */
void *qxl_phys2virt(PCIQXLDevice *qxl, QXLPHYSICAL phys, int group_id);
void qxl_guest_bug(PCIQXLDevice *qxl, const char *msg, ...);
